Doris Haslam collection

  • CA PCA Acc4978
  • Collection
  • [ca. 1870]-2000, predominant 1935-2000

This collection consists of various textual and photographic records of Doris Muncey Haslam spanning the years ca. 1870 to 2000. The records are divided into four series: the Genealogical notes and correspondence series details Doris Haslam's continued interest in genealogy; the Scrapbooks series contains five of Doris Haslam's scrapbooks; the Personal correspondence and household accounts series consists of an account book and letters; and the Miscellaneous records series contains newsletters, postcards and a draft copy of the community history of Springfield.

Eileen Oulton collection

  • CA PCNAM AM0006
  • Collection
  • 1960-1978

This collection consists of genealogical and historical material relating to the town of Alberton, Prince Edward Island, which Eileen Oulton collected or complied between the years 1960 and 1978. The collection is divided into 15 series: Photographs; Genealogy; Interviews; Local Histories; Folk Songs; Diaries; Newspaper articles written by Eileen Oulton; Newspaper articles; Royal Canadian Legion, Tignish Branch #6 Monthly Bulletin; Heritage Foundation newsletters; Alberton and Area Churches; Artifact and photo ledgers; Shipping Casualties and notes on ships; P.E.I. Railway Stations; and Miscellaneous. The images in Series 1 were collected from local residents with the assistance of Frank Pridham. Series 2 - Genealogy includes genealogical cards organized by family name, family genealogical charts, obituaries, Catholic Church records, Cemetery records, and other various finding aids.

The Maple Leaf

  • CA PCA Acc2782
  • Fonds
  • 1927-1947

This fonds consists of original, photocopied, and microfilmed copies of issues of "The Maple Leaf" magazine dating from 1907 to 1947. Originally a monthly magazine, publication changed to a bi-monthly format in 1942. The magazine includes: news stories and reminiscences of Prince Edward Island, Nova Scotia, New Brunswick, Maine, Massachusetts, and California; poetry; correspondence; the column "Persons and Places, Past and Present" containing stories about people and vital statistics; and short fiction stories in "The Children's Department".

This fonds is arranged by the format of the records: bound issues, individual issues housed in files, and microfilmed issues.
